电子-uCOSII2.91UCGUI3.90A.rar
标题 "电子-uCOSII2.91UCGUI3.90A.rar" 提供了有关这个压缩包文件的关键信息,它包含的是一个基于微控制器(Microcontroller)开发的软件资源,具体是uCOSII操作系统版本2.91与UCGUI图形用户界面库版本3.90A的组合。这些组件常用于单片机或嵌入式系统,特别是针对STM32系列微控制器的F0、F1和F2型号。 uCOSII,全称为MicroC/OS-II,是一个实时操作系统(RTOS)。它是为嵌入式系统设计的,具有可剥夺型多任务内核,支持抢占式调度,确保任务之间的快速响应。uCOSII的核心特性包括任务管理、内存管理、信号量、消息队列、事件标志组、时间管理等,这些功能使得开发者能够构建复杂的、实时性能良好的嵌入式应用。 UCGUI,即Unicode-based Graphical User Interface,是一个专门为资源受限的嵌入式设备设计的图形用户界面库。UCGUI 3.90A版本提供了基本的图形元素如窗口、按钮、文本框、列表等,以及动画、触摸屏支持等功能。它优化了内存占用,适应了微控制器有限的存储资源。在STM32这样的微控制器上,UCGUI可以帮助开发者创建直观、易于操作的用户界面,提升用户体验。 STM32是意法半导体(STMicroelectronics)推出的一款基于ARM Cortex-M内核的32位微控制器系列。F0、F1和F2是STM32家族的不同产品线,各自具有不同的性能、功耗和功能集。STM32-F0是基础系列,适合低功耗和低成本应用;STM32-F1是主流系列,提供广泛的性能和存储选择;STM32-F2则提供了更高的处理能力和集成度,适合更复杂的应用场景。 综合以上信息,我们可以得出,这个压缩包"电子-uCOSII2.91UCGUI3.90A.rar"是为使用STM32 F0、F1或F2系列微控制器的开发者准备的。它包含了uCOSII实时操作系统和UCGUI图形库,旨在帮助他们开发具备实时性、高效能且有用户友好的图形界面的嵌入式应用。开发者可以下载解压后,结合官方文档和示例代码,将这两个组件整合进他们的STM32项目中,以实现更强大的功能和更精美的视觉效果。
- 1
- 2
- 3
- 4
- 5
- 6
- 14
- 粉丝: 329
- 资源: 2万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助